Tomorrow - Saturday 20 April - sees the start of this year's Swindon Blossom Festival.
All are welcome to join in celebrations of the arrival of Spring in the town at South Swindon Parish Council locations GWR Park, the Town Gardens Café, Badbury Park Library, Shaftesbury Lake and Buckhurst and East Wichel Tiny Forests.
The festival runs from 20 to 28 April, and planned events include:
- Saturday 20 April - Nature Discovery Day at Shaftesbury Lake, 10am-2pm
- Monday 22 April - Earth Day celebrations at East Wichel Tiny Forest
- Tuesday 23 April - Earth Day circus activities at Buckhurst Tiny Forest and Old Town Library Story Picnic at Town Gardens 11am-noon
- Various dates - A broad range of events at the Town Gardens Cafe, including Yoga, craft and art workshops
- Wednesday 24 April - Build a Bug Hotel at Town Gardens, 2pm
- Sunday 28 April - Blossom Festival at GWR Park and Swindon Growers Summit at Swindon Hub, 10.30am-4.30pm
